Holgate is on a three-game streak of home losses, and Ottoville a 15-game streak of away losses dating back to last season. However, someone's due for a change in luck on Saturday. The Holgate Tigers will welcome the Ottoville Big Green at 11:00 a.m. Ottoville took a loss in their last game and will be looking to turn the tables on Holgate, who comes in off a win.
Holgate is headed in fresh off scoring the most runs they have all season. Their pitchers stepped up to hand Gorham Fayette a 15-0 shutout on Friday. The win was some much needed relief for the Tigers as it spelled an end to their five-game losing streak.
Lici Escamilla made a big impact no matter where she played. On the mound, she pitched three innings while giving up no earned runs off one hit. She has been nothing but reliable: she hasn't given up more than two walks in three consecutive appearances. She was also big at the plate, going 1-for-2 with two stolen bases, one triple, and two RBI. Those two stolen bases gave her a new career-high.
In other batting news, Lyndee Palte was incredible, going a perfect 1-for-1 with two stolen bases, two runs, and two RBI. Those two RBI gave her a new career-high. The team also got some help courtesy of Olivia Sifuentes, who went 1-for-2 with two RBI, one run, and one double.
Meanwhile, Ottoville fell victim to Antwerp and their airtight pitching crew on Thursday. They lost 13-0 to the Archers.
Holgate picked up their first road victory, bumping their record up to 2-12. As for Ottoville, their loss dropped their record down to 1-14.
Holgate came out on top in a nail-biter against Ottoville when the teams last played back in May of 2024, sneaking past 11-10. Will the Tigers repeat their success, or do the Big Green have a new game plan this time around? We'll find out soon enough.
